Why Sustainability Matters in the Amazon

The Amazon rainforest is one of the most biodiverse places on Earth and a source of spiritual renewal for countless generations. We recognize that every retreat we host must also be an act of stewardship – caring for the environment and preserving its sacred energy for future generations.

Our Eco-Friendly Practices

Jungle Respect & Resource Management

We work closely with the local Kukama community to ensure that every aspect of our retreat respects the jungle’s natural rhythms. From limiting the size of our groups to using biodegradable materials, we reduce our ecological footprint while maintaining the integrity of your healing journey.

Supporting Local Communities

Our connection to the Amazon includes a deep respect for its people. We collaborate with local artisans and farmers to source fresh, organic ingredients for our dieta-compliant meals. This supports the local economy and ensures that every meal is an offering to both body and spirit.

Minimizing Waste & Impact

We actively reduce waste through mindful consumption and waste separation. Recyclable materials are carefully managed, and we aim to minimize single-use plastics and unnecessary packaging throughout the retreat.
